Following the BBC's Panorama program exposed several clinics that rushed patients through online tests, without following the national guidelines, the accuracy of private ADHD assessments has been called into question. It is important not to take too much notice of the anecdotal evidence presented in the program.

Service wait times for ADHD assessments can be extremely long, and it's not surprising that many patients opt to pay for an assessment by a private practitioner.

The procedure for an ADHD assessment may differ from provider to provider however, it usually begins with the completion of a questionnaire to determine whether you have several ADHD symptoms. As part of the screening process, you may also be given a form to give to family members as well as friends or colleagues. These forms are crucial to ensure that your appointment goes smoothly and that the doctor will examine the information ahead of the time they will meet you.

If the results of your screening indicate a high likelihood that you exhibit ADHD symptoms, you are invited to a face-to-face ADHD assessment with the psychiatrist. It is typically an hour or less and will involve a discussion about your current problems, your history with ADHD symptoms, and the impact that they have on your daily functioning. The psychiatrist will ask how much ADHD symptoms affect your daily life and in particular situations like work or school.

The psychiatrist will then prepare a detailed assessment report and discuss how much for private adhd assessment the results of the assessment can inform your future treatment decisions. This will include whether or not you wish to consider the possibility of a medication trial and, if so, which option is most appropriate for your particular circumstance.

In the majority of cases, the first step in an ADHD assessment is to have the person complete the questionnaire. They may also bring in previous medical records and self-assessments. The professional will then conduct a formal assessment and may use an assessment system. Additionally, some professionals may opt to include an at-home computer test, such as TOVA which could provide a robust quantitative marker for ADHD by measuring attention and impulsivity.

Once the information is gathered and analyzed, the doctor will create a diagnosis. This will be based on the individual's overall performance in different social circumstances. They will also consider if the person has co-morbid conditions which could be causing their symptoms. In addition, they will consider the impact on specific circumstances, like parental disapproval and work stressors.

It is important to note that an ADHD evaluation does not lead to prescriptions for medication. The doctor will only prescribe medication when they believe that the patient requires treatment for ADHD to function effectively.

A private ADHD assessment is a medical exam performed by a qualified healthcare professional. They are typically psychiatrists with experience in diagnosing ADHD and related disorders like depression, anxiety and dyslexia.

The examination is conducted by an expert medical professional who will meet with the patient and review any paperwork or questionnaires that were submitted prior to the appointment. Additional tests or screenings could be recommended depending on the patient's condition and circumstances.

Adults who suffer from ADHD are often asked to fill out the Diagnostic Interview for ADHD In Adults (DIVA), an established questionnaire that is used by many psychiatrists in the world. It asks questions regarding the frequency of symptoms and their impact on the person's lifestyle as well as relationships at work. It is crucial for adults with ADHD to be honest and transparent in answering the questions, so they can get a valid diagnosis.

Children with ADHD might require a more thorough evaluation that could include interviews with coaches, teachers, and daycare providers. The specialist may also request a sample of the child's report cards as well as schoolwork.

In certain situations the doctor may want to visit the patient at the clinic or at their home in order to observe their symptoms and behaviours. They will request to see their GP referral letter, any paperwork or questionnaires completed in advance.

If a GP is referring an ADHD patient for evaluation they should be familiar with the NICE guidelines (87) which stipulate that only healthcare professionals specializing in ADHD can make a diagnosis or deny an ADHD diagnosis. This includes GPs and consultants psychiatrists.

ADHD is a neurologic condition that affects the way the brain functions. It can cause difficulties in areas such as working memory, planning, and organisation. The disorder can affect children and adults. It is important to get a specialist's assessment of those who are suffering from symptoms. A thorough assessment can provide the information you require to comprehend the symptoms and decide on the best treatment for you.

A specialist can provide an in-depth diagnostic interview than a quiz online, which cannot be able to take into consideration the entire range of symptoms that individuals may be experiencing. A thorough discussion with an expert in mental health psychologist, psychiatrist or psychiatrist is required to diagnose ADHD.
